The Cat 5 spring has a rate of 240 lbs/inch and has metal spherical bearings on each end, most other tuner springs are 175 and come with rubber front eye bushings. Any of those leaf springs will ride better than the Cat5. On my wife's 73 Camaro we removed Hotchkis leafs and installed the Cat5. Much rougher ride. tires make a big difference in ride quality too. With our race tires the car rode terrible on the Cat5's, with street rubber it was tolerable, still stiff but not as harsh.

I have replaced a couple sets of those Cat 5s for complaining customers (harsh ride) and replaced them with Hotchkis or DSE (lower rate and rubber bushings). There is a point where you get way to solid and stiff with leafs, especially for a street car.
